Fluorescent Dye 568 alkyne, 5-isomer
Description
Fluorescent Dye 568 is an effective tool for labeling purposes. The excitation maximum of Fluorescent Dye 568 lies at 572 nm and its emission maximum is at 598 nm. Fluorescent Dye 568 has excellent photochemical stability and brightness. Fluorescent Dye 568 alkyne derivate is an effective tool for labeling purposes. It is easily detected in the Texas Red channel with a high signal-to-noise ratio in different biological samples. Also, Fluorescent Dye 568 alkyne is water soluble and insensitive to pH changes between pH 4 and pH 10. Mild reaction conditions are suitable for most biomolecules, cells, and tissues. Bioconjugation with Fluorescent Dye 568 alkyne presents a powerful technique for the production of fluorescently labeled biomolecules. Fluorescent Dye 568 alkyne is recommended for visualization procedures, including fluorescence microscopy, flow cytometry, and other applications where label brightness and photostability are required.
Absorption Maxima
572 nm
Extinction Coefficient
94238 M-1cm-1
Emission Maxima
598 nm
Fluorescence Quantum Yield
0.912
Mass Spec M+ Shift after Conjugation
731.2
Purity
95% (by 1H NMR and HPLC-MS).
Molecular Formula
C36H31N3K2O10S2
Molecular Weight
807.97 kDa
Product Form
Violet powder.
Solubility
Good in water, DMF, and DMSO.
Storage
Shipped at room temperature. Upon delivery, store in the dark at -20°C. Avoid prolonged exposure to light. Desiccate.
